|
Подключение к БД Oracle из программы на С#
|
|||
---|---|---|---|
#18+
компилятору не нравится почему-то строка, он на неё указывает Код: c# 1.
описание для ошибки: Код: plsql 1. 2. 3. 4. 5. 6. 7.
... |
|||
:
Нравится:
Не нравится:
|
|||
23.11.2012, 14:30 |
|
Подключение к БД Oracle из программы на С#
|
|||
---|---|---|---|
#18+
наш человек в гаванекомпилятору не нравится почему-то строка, он на неё указывает Код: c# 1.
run-time ошибка к компилятору отношения не имеет. наш человек в гаванеописание для ошибки: Код: plsql 1. 2.
Уберите из текста запроса точку с запятойю Должно быть так: Код: c# 1.
... |
|||
:
Нравится:
Не нравится:
|
|||
23.11.2012, 17:26 |
|
Подключение к БД Oracle из программы на С#
|
|||
---|---|---|---|
#18+
sphinx_mv : спасибо, помогло! а могли бы вкратце пояснить почему через tnsnames.ora коннект работает быстрее, чем напрямую (direct соединение)? ... |
|||
:
Нравится:
Не нравится:
|
|||
23.11.2012, 17:54 |
|
Подключение к БД Oracle из программы на С#
|
|||
---|---|---|---|
#18+
авторВо-первых, чего такую "древнюю" версию используете? "На сейчас" актуальна версия ODAC1120320 - на релиза на 3 "по-свежее" будет... у меня БД Oracle 11.2.0.1 но, если версия ODAC будет выше, чем версия БД ничего страшного не произойдёт, работать оно будет? т.е. версия БД может быть к примеру 9i, а ODAC c InstantClient 11.2.0.3 и работать будет нормально? ... |
|||
:
Нравится:
Не нравится:
|
|||
23.11.2012, 18:26 |
|
Подключение к БД Oracle из программы на С#
|
|||
---|---|---|---|
#18+
наш человек в гаванеа могли бы вкратце пояснить почему через tnsnames.ora коннект работает быстрее, чем напрямую (direct соединение)?По идее вроде бы не должно, но большего не скажу: с БД на Oracle я "общаюсь" как разработчик, а не администратор - а этот вопрос является непосредственно администраторским. Если он Вас сильно волнует, задайте его в "более специализированном" месте . Возможно, Вам там ответят. ... |
|||
:
Нравится:
Не нравится:
|
|||
23.11.2012, 19:09 |
|
Подключение к БД Oracle из программы на С#
|
|||
---|---|---|---|
#18+
наш человек в гаванеу меня БД Oracle 11.2.0.1 но, если версия ODAC будет выше, чем версия БД ничего страшного не произойдёт, работать оно будет? т.е. версия БД может быть к примеру 9i, а ODAC c InstantClient 11.2.0.3 и работать будет нормально?Ничего "страшного" не будет. Зато "в плюсах" частично пофиксеные "старые" баги + новые фичи, но и "в минусах" не до конца вычищеные "старые" + некоторое количество "новых" багов... Перед использованием в "рабочем проекте", соответственно, необходимо проверять в "изолированной среде" как работает новая версия - стандартное требование для любого нового продукта. ... |
|||
:
Нравится:
Не нравится:
|
|||
23.11.2012, 19:21 |
|
Подключение к БД Oracle из программы на С#
|
|||
---|---|---|---|
#18+
sphinx_mv : Могли бы вы ещё показать на примере использования метода dr.GetOracleDate() Я хочу в метку label1 передать значение GetOracleDate, но не совсем понимаю как это сделать. Гугл мне сказал, что аргументом для GetOracleDate является int Код: plsql 1. 2. 3.
самый первый вопрос, который у меня появляется, какое значение типа int подставлять в качестве аргумента? и покажите на примере, пожалуйста. ... |
|||
:
Нравится:
Не нравится:
|
|||
23.11.2012, 19:22 |
|
Подключение к БД Oracle из программы на С#
|
|||
---|---|---|---|
#18+
sphinx_mv: у меня следующая проблема: хочу создать несколько меток (label1, label2,..., label N), и в кажду метку передавать различный тип данных. Например, в метку label1 буду передавать тип данных varchar2 из БД, в label2 тип number, а в label3 тип date. Как это организовать? я посмотрел, что в visual studio есть методы? (правильно назвал?): GetString GetChar GetDateTime я не понимаю какие аргументы подставлять, вернее какое значение для этих аргументов. так я не совсем понимаю, почему GetString принимает значение 0, а не 1, например? Код: c# 1.
этим кодом я пытался в текстовое поле вставить результат первого селекта, а в метку передать текущее время из БД. но у меня НЕ получилось. Код: c# 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22. 23. 24.
... |
|||
:
Нравится:
Не нравится:
|
|||
23.11.2012, 19:45 |
|
Подключение к БД Oracle из программы на С#
|
|||
---|---|---|---|
#18+
наш человек в гаване sphinx_mv : Могли бы вы ещё показать на примере использования метода dr.GetOracleDate() ... самый первый вопрос, который у меня появляется, какое значение типа int подставлять в качестве аргумента? и покажите на примере, пожалуйста.:) Читать Oracle Data Provider for .NET Developer's Guide ... Подробнее про OracleDataReader Class ... Примеры "на любой вкус и цвет" есть в каталоге, куда Вы устанавливали ODAC (подкаталог ODP.NET)... ... |
|||
:
Нравится:
Не нравится:
|
|||
23.11.2012, 20:13 |
|
|
start [/forum/topic.php?fid=20&msg=38051250&tid=1405600]: |
0ms |
get settings: |
11ms |
get forum list: |
13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
65ms |
get topic data: |
9ms |
get forum data: |
2ms |
get page messages: |
42ms |
get tp. blocked users: |
2ms |
others: | 13ms |
total: | 163ms |
0 / 0 |